FY 2011 CVISN Funding. DOT-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ration. The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ration?s Commercial Vehicle Information Systems and Networks grant program provides financial assistance to eligible States to 1) improve the safety and productivity of commercial vehicles and drivers and 2) reduce costs associated with commercial vehicle... $1,000,000-$2,500,000 per award; $25,000,000 total program funding; ~15 awards expected.
